
We are seeking a strategic and detail-oriented Program Manager to lead and coordinate complex programs consisting of multiple projects.
In this role, you will be responsible for planning, executing, and delivering programs that align with organizational goals while ensuring timelines, budgets, and quality standards are met.
The ideal candidate will have a strong background in project and program management, excellent stakeholder management skills, and a proven ability to lead cross-functional teams in a dynamic environ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Plan, manage, and oversee end-to-end delivery of key programs composed of multiple interdependent projects
- Define program objectives, scope, timeline, resource needs, budgets, and success criteria
- Coordinate cross-functional project teams and manage interdependencies across projects
- Ensure alignment of program goals with strategic business objectives
- Develop detailed program plans, track milestones, and report on progress to senior stakeholders
- Identify and manage program risks, issues, and changes to scope or timelines
- Communicate effectively with stakeholders at all levels, including executive leadership
- Implement and maintain program governance frameworks, best practices, and reporting standards
- Facilitate program reviews and retrospectives to drive continuous improvement
- Ensure all deliverables meet quality standards and business expectations
- Manage relationships with vendors, clients, and third-party stakeholders where applicable
Requirements &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Engineering, Computer Science, or related field (Master's or MBA preferred)
- 7-10+ years of project/program management experience, with a track record of managing large, complex initiatives
- Strong knowledge of project management methodologies (Agile, Scrum, Waterfall, or hybrid approaches)
- PMP, PgMP, PRINCE2, or similar certifications are highly preferred
- Exc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and build trust
- Proficient in project management and collaboration tools (e., MS Project, Jira, Asana, Trello, Confluence)
- Strong financial acumen and experience managing large budgets
